Analysis

In 2020, tourist departures per 1000 vs gdp in China stood at 14.26.

The figure is down 86.9% on the previous year and down 66.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, tourist departures per 1000 vs gdp in China peaked at 108.63 in 2019 and was at its lowest, 3.7, in 1995.

That places China 101st out of 110 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Tourist departures per 1000 vs gdp in China, year by year

Annual values for Tourist departures per 1000 vs gdp in China, 1995 to 2020.
Year Value Change
1995 3.7
1996 4.11 +11.0%
1997 4.29 +4.3%
1998 6.74 +57.0%
1999 7.33 +8.8%
2000 8.25 +12.6%
2001 9.49 +15.0%
2002 12.9 +36.0%
2003 15.62 +21.1%
2004 22.16 +41.8%
2005 23.68 +6.9%
2006 26.19 +10.6%
2007 30.89 +17.9%
2008 34.37 +11.3%
2009 35.5 +3.3%
2010 42.46 +19.6%
2011 51.64 +21.6%
2012 60.74 +17.6%
2013 71.2 +17.2%
2014 84 +18.0%
2015 91.58 +9.0%
2016 96.24 +5.1%
2017 101.27 +5.2%
2018 105.51 +4.2%
2019 108.63 +3.0%
2020 14.26 -86.9%
